Steps
- 1
Mix the oats, mashed banana, almonds, and dried fruits (crushed or chopped into pieces. Not powdered, to keep the texture).
- 2
Add honey and almond butter. Mix well for 2 minutes by hand.
- 3
Place in a dish, approximately 20x10cm for 10 large bars, lined with parchment paper.
- 4
Bake in the oven for 30 minutes at 180°C.
- 5
Storing in the fridge helps the bars firm up.
